The Campania Region awards the students of the Salesian Institute “Sacro Cuore” of Vomero

Share

A multi-colored water bottle, with the historic logo of the Salesian House redesigned and stylized in a unique way, with a striking phrase printed underneath: "class is not water." This is the original initiative of the students of the fourth IT (Administration, Finance and Marketing) of the Salesian Institute "Sacro Cuore" of Vomero (Naples), awarded with a scholarship by the Campania Region as part of the competition that included an in-depth study of the theme: "Reduction, reuse, recycling and recovery. Ideas and projects to transform waste into resources for environmental protection”, announced by Palazzo Santa Lucia for the 2023-2024 school year.

The award ceremony took place in the spaces of the Mostra d'Oltremare in Naples, on the occasion of the “Green Med Symposium”. The idea of ​​the “water bottle” was wanted by the entire class council, in what was immediately seen as a sort of “technical test” of the challenges, in a few years, the kids will be called to face in the world of finance and marketing, declined, however, according to an eco-sustainability perspective. A real business simulation, therefore, aimed at implementing the practical skills acquired during the school year, producing “goods and profits”, without however departing from the norms of the so-called “civil living”.

The students of the IV IT have in fact transformed themselves into many small entrepreneurs, but with an eye on those issues related to the protection and respect of the planet, the conscious use of drinking water and the consumption of plastic. In short: what is called an experience of civic education and active citizenship, which the Campania Region has shown to appreciate quite a bit.
